Las Sendas

Discover Las Sendas, an upscale desert retreat on the eastern edge of Mesa. This master-planned community blends luxury living with natural beauty. Championship golf courses wind through saguaro-studded terrain. Outdoor enthusiasts will love direct access to Usery Mountain hiking trails. Resort-style pools and tennis courts offer refreshing breaks from desert adventures. Custom homes with mountain views provide a peaceful escape from city life while still offering modern conveniences.

Dobson Ranch

Dobson Ranch offers a peaceful retreat with family-friendly areas and abundant outdoor spaces. This planned community in Mesa features multiple lakes, walking paths, and the championship Dobson Ranch Golf Course. Tennis courts and community pools provide active recreation options amid the southwestern architecture. The neighborhood's wide streets and manicured landscapes create a tranquil residential atmosphere away from urban hustle. Mountain views frame this suburban oasis where desert landscaping complements man-made water features. Travellers appreciate the quiet environment while still being close to Mesa's attractions.

East Mesa

East Mesa balances desert beauty with suburban comfort just outside Phoenix. Golf enthusiasts can tee off at Las Sendas or Augusta Ranch courses. Families love the spacious parks and hiking trails in Usery Mountain Regional Park. The Salt River offers refreshing tubing adventures during hot Arizona summers. Desert landscapes provide a stunning backdrop for outdoor activities in this affordable area. Superstition Springs Centre serves local shopping needs while mountain views create dramatic vistas. Most visitors will want to rent a car for easy access to attractions throughout Mesa and beyond.

West Second Street Historic District

Step back in time along the tree-lined streets of West Second Street Historic District. Early 20th century Craftsman and Bungalow homes showcase Mesa's architectural heritage through wooden porches and handcrafted details. This quiet residential area offers an authentic glimpse into Arizona's past. The area invites peaceful strolls beneath mature shade trees. While primarily residential, visitors can easily reach Mesa Arts Centre and Arizona Museum of Natural History nearby. The district's charm comes from its preservation rather than tourist attractions.

Superstition Springs

Superstition Springs offers a budget-friendly base with suburban comforts just outside Phoenix. The Superstition Springs Centre mall anchors this family-oriented area with department stores, restaurants, and cinemas. Dramatic mountain backdrops frame wide streets lined with earth-toned buildings and desert landscaping. Golf enthusiasts can tee off at Superstition Springs Golf Club. The area provides affordable chain hotels with pools and nearby holiday rentals. A car is recommended as public transit is limited, though the Superstition Springs Transit Centre connects to greater Mesa.

Best time to go to Mesa

The best time to visit Mesa can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Mesa falls in July, when visitor numbers are average and weather is sunny with no rain. The coolest average temperature in Mesa falls in January, vis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is sunny with no r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January54.7°F (12.6°C)No RainSunnySlightly HighAverage
February57.9°F (14.4°C)No RainSunnySlightly HighSlightly High
March65.5°F (18.6°C)No RainSunnySlightly HighSlightly High
April73.6°F (23.1°C)No RainSunnyAverageSlightly High
May81.1°F (27.3°C)No RainSunnySlightly LowAverage
June91.6°F (33.1°C)No RainSunnyAverageSlightly Low
July94.8°F (34.9°C)No RainSunnyAverageSlightly Low
August93.9°F (34.4°C)No RainSunnySlightly LowSlightly Low
September88.9°F (31.6°C)No RainSunnyAverageAverage
October77.0°F (25.0°C)No RainSunnySlightly LowAverage
November64.8°F (18.2°C)No RainSunnyAverageAverage
December54.9°F (12.7°C)No RainSunnyAverageAverage

How should I get around Mesa?
You can access metro transport at Center Street / Main Street Station, Country Club / Main Street Station and Mesa Drive / Main Street Station. If you want to venture out around the area, you may want a rental car in Mesa for your journey.
What's the seasonal weather like in Mesa?
The hottest months are usually July and June, with an average temperature of 34°C, while the coldest months are January and December, with an average of 15°C. Average annual precipitation for Mesa is 262 mm.
